Hi,

How can I troubleshoot K-values mismatches ? In lab 36 you need to change
the k-values which raised the question with me how to troubleshoot it .
Suppose that the change the K-values on the backbone routers in the lab...

Is there a debug/show command whichs shows me the k-values that are
received/send by an EIGRP neighbor.

I tried all the debugging commands but no luck ...
